Harrell Funeral Home of Kingsland Obituary

Tona Welch Simnacher passed away on December 25, 2017 after suffering a heart attack. Tona was born to Colonel John B. and Naomia (Branscum) Welch on June 16, 1944 in Kermit, Texas

Tona attended South Dade High School and Texas Tech University.  She owned and operated Simnacher Farms and...
